Port usage (ARINC for VxWorks code)
A Port Usage is not an ARINC item, but on the Configuration Diagram's toolbar there is a Port Usage button that creates a UML Association between an Application Part and a Port on a Configuration Diagram. When generated, a Port Usage results in an APEX queuing port or APEX sampling port being generated.
A Port Usage link between an Application Part and a Port results in that Port being generated in the Configuration XML and the application startup code that is generated for the Application Part. For information about how Queuing Ports and Sampling Ports are generated, see the related links below.
To define port usage on a Configuration Diagram: click the Port Usage toolbar button, and the click the following items:
An Application Part, and then a Source Queuing Port or Source Sampling Port on the Application Part's parent Partition Part.
A Destination Queuing Port or Destination Sampling Port on a Partition Part, and then an Application Part within that Partition Part.
